9ct Gold 1930s Pigeon Flying Club Fob

1920 - 1940
Description

A 1930s 9ct gold pigeon flying club fob, originally designed to hang from a pocket watch chain.

The fob measures 25mm x 37mm high including the fixed loop and it weighs 7.8g. The back of the fob is engraved and reads, "R.H.F.C, grand average, 1933, R G Barton" and it is hallmarked for Birmingham 1932.

The overall condition of the fob is good for its age with just general surface marks, nothing serious.
